Ingredients You’ll Need
To prepare this easy pancake recipe, you will need the following ingredients:
– Pancake mix: You can use a store-bought pancake mix, which often includes various flavor options, or you can make your own mix at home using fl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
– Milk: Whole milk will give you the best results, but you can also opt for low-fat milk or any milk alternative such as almond or oat milk if you prefer.
– Eggs: Adding eggs is optional, depending on the pancake mix used. Some mixes are designed to be egg-free, while others may benefit from the extra richness that eggs provide.
Preparing the Batter
The first step in making your pancakes is preparing the batter. Follow these guidelines to ensure your pancakes are light and fluffy:
1. Measure the pancake mix and liquid: Refer to the instructions on your pancake mix packaging for the correct proportions. Generally, the ratio is about 1 cup of pancake mix to 3/4 cup of liquid.
2. Mix gently: Combine the dry pancake mix and milk (and eggs, if using) in a mixing bowl. Stir gently until the ingredients are just combined. It’s essential to leave the batter slightly lumpy—overmixing can lead to tough pancakes.
Cooking the Pancakes
Now that you have your batter ready, it’s time to cook the pancakes:
1. Preheat your skillet: Heat a non-stick skillet or griddle over medium heat for about 5 minutes. To check if it’s hot enough, sprinkle a few drops of water onto the surface; they should sizzle and evaporate quickly.
2. Pour the batter: Using a ladle, pour the batter onto the skillet. A standard pancake size is about 1/4 to 1/3 cup.
3. Cook until bubbles form: Wait until bubbles start to appear on the surface of the pancake. This usually takes about 2-3 minutes. Flip the pancake with a spatula and cook for another 1-2 minutes on the other side until golden brown.

Topping Ideas
Once your pancakes are cooked, it’s time to make them even more delicious with various toppings. Here are some popular options:
– Classic syrup or honey: Maple syrup is a timeless choice that enhances the sweetness of pancakes. Alternatively, honey provides a natural sweetness.
– Fresh fruits: Top your pancakes with fresh fruits like strawberries, blueberries, or banana slices for added nutrition and flavor.
– Whipped cream or yogurt: Adding a dollop of whipped cream or yogurt creates a creamy contrast that can elevate the taste of your pancakes.
Tips for Perfect Pancakes
To ensure your pancakes turn out perfectly every time, consider these tips:
– Use a light touch: When mixing the batter, avoid stirring too vigorously. A few lumps are okay, as they will help create a fluffier texture.
– Add extras for variety: Feel free to experiment by adding chocolate chips, nuts, or even spices like cinnamon for a unique flavor twist.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
While making pancakes is relatively straightforward, there are some common pitfalls to avoid:
– Using too much liquid: This can lead to thin, flat pancakes. Always adhere to the recommended liquid-to-dry mix ratio.
– Not preheating the skillet: Failing to preheat the pan adequately can result in uneven cooking, causing some pancakes to burn while others remain undercooked.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the best pancake recipe using pancake mix?
The best pancake recipe using pancake mix typically includes adding an egg, milk, and a splash of vanilla extract for extra flavor. For fluffy pancakes, use slightly less liquid than recommended on the pancake mix box and let the batter rest for a few minutes. You can also mix in blueberries or chocolate chips for added taste.
How do you make pancakes from pancake mix without eggs?
To make pancakes from pancake mix without eggs, you can substitute the egg with a mashed banana, applesauce, or a flaxseed mixture (1 tablespoon of flaxseed meal mixed with 2.5 tablespoons of water). Adjust the liquid in your pancake mix recipe accordingly to keep the batter consistency right. This will help you achieve delicious pancakes while catering to dietary restrictions.
Why do my pancakes made from pancake mix come out flat?
Pancakes made from pancake mix can come out flat if the batter is overmixed or if the leavening agents in the mix have expired. To prevent this, gently stir the ingredients until just combined, as overmixing can deflate the bubbles that help pancakes rise. Additionally, check the expiration date on your pancake mix to ensure freshness.

How can I enhance the flavor of pancakes made with pancake mix?
To enhance the flavor of pancakes made with pancake mix, consider adding spices like cinnamon or nutmeg to the dry ingredients. You can also substitute buttermilk for regular milk or add a bit of melted butter for richness. Toppings such as fresh fruit, whipped cream, or flavored syrups can also elevate the overall taste experience.
